Microweber CMS version 2.0.1 is vulnerable to stored Cross Site Scripting (XSS) via the profile picture file upload functionality.

This medium-severity CVE scores 5.4 under NVD CVSS v3. EPSS exploit probability: 0.2%, top 64% of all CVEs by exploit prediction.
